Summary
Phoebe Bridgers has announced her first solo tour in three years, called the "Lost Tour," following a series of surprise pop-up shows. The tour kicks off in September with special guest Alex G, with European dates in November and December featuring former Black Country, New Road vocalist Isaac Wood. The tour is phone-free, and $1 from every North American ticket sold will be donated to RAINN (Rape, Abuse & Incest National Network).
